摘要
通过利用大型通用软件ANSYS,对钢筋混凝土(RC)试件梁的碳纤维布粘贴方案的抗弯性能进行了非线性有限元分析。对卸载或不卸载时预应力碳纤维布加固梁进行仿真分析,提出了利用单元生与死实现不卸载时加固的方法,以及使用升温法施加预应力。使用ANSYS分析的结果与实验分析结果吻合较好,从而此方法可在一定程度上有效代替试验分析方法。
A finite element method is used to analyse the anti-bending function of the beams using ANSYS program when they are uninstalled or when they are not uninstalled.In finite element analysis,the methods have been put forward that bring prestress to bear on CFRP sheets(the method of the rise in temperature)and that strengthen when it is not uninstalled by birth and death of elements.It's shown that the result of finite element analysis by ANSYS has a close agreement with the experimental result.So,finite element analysis method is feasible and available in practical application.
